Fuel Reserve Tank Motorcycles. Since most motorcycles do not have fuel gauges the kind engineers that designed our bikes decided to include a reserve fuel tank inside the main fuel tank. Look for a small switch, knob, or lever on the side or underside of the. Motorcycles typically have a reserve fuel switch located near the fuel tank. The motorcycle rider can then switch to reserve and use this reserve fuel to travel to the nearest gas station. The normal run tube rises about 35mm from the bottom of the tank. A reserve tank is a part of the main fuel tank designed as a fallback option for the rider in case the fuel runs out in the main fuel tank.
